The F135 Exhaust Component Integrated Product Team (CIPT), is searching for a highly motivated Project engineer to support the latest and greatest Production fighter jet engine program, the F135. A successful candidate will be a talented, goal oriented, focused Project Engineer who wants to be an integral part of Hot Section Engineering and the Exhaust engine section. Project engineers are part of an integrated product team (IPT) made up of designers, durability engineers, structures engineers as well as system analysts whose goal is to solve module level/part level technical challenges. This would require the overall coordination and leading of a multi-disciplinary engineering team to meet the technical, cost, and schedule requirements throughout the product life cycle.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Activities would consist of coordinating designs (Class I & Class II Engineering Changes), fabrication (manufacturing/suppliers- vendor trips), validation (Engine Build-Test-Teardown, ACIs- Analytical Condition Inspection, FMRs- Failure Malfunction Report), and sustainment (Component Field Limits, Merlins-Field Inquiries, Deviation Requests) activities.
  • Within the IPT framework, you would be responsible for handling tasks, leading IPTs, planning budgets (Military EV CAM) and schedules, sustaining fielded engines, resolving manufacturing issues, handling budgets, and communicating task status to the Exhaust Component Integrated Product Team (CIPT) and F135 Military Program.
  • Today, the F135 Exhaust CIPT is heavily focused on solving highly visible tasks ranging from component field investigations/root cause to Class I component engineering changes, Production deliveries and Field Sustainment.
  • Each Project Engineer is responsible for all the above relative to their component of responsibility.
